Through various programs and community involvement, Littleton Adventist Hospital is committed to serving the growing healthcare needs of our community.
- Littleton Adventist Hospital is proud to participate in the Institute for Healthcare Improvement’s 5 Million Lives Campaign to improve patient care practices and outcomes.
- Littleton Adventist Hospital is proud to support the Greater Littleton Youth Initiative (GLYI) by contributing $150,000 over a three year period to The Yellow Ribbon Suicide Prevention Program and Applied Suicide Intervention Skills Training (ASIST), two, comprehensive, community-based suicide prevention education and training programs targeting at-risk youth. - Doctors Care - Since 1988, Doctors Care has provided healthcare to more than 16,500 residents of Douglas, Arapahoe and Elbert counties. Littleton Adventist Hospital is proud to be one of the four hospitals in the area who provide services to Doctors Care patients. Learn more about Doctors Care...
